Understanding the Dynamics of Low-Variance Slots
In traditional slot gaming, the concepts of volatility—often termed variance—play a crucial role in shaping player experience and operator profitability. Low-variance slots feature frequent, smaller wins, which foster heightened engagement and prolonged gameplay sessions. This model appeals especially to beginners or players seeking entertainment without substantial financial risk, serving as an avenue for consistent positive reinforcement. Conversely, high-variance slots cater to gamblers chasing larger jackpots but with less frequent payouts.
| Variance Type | Winning Frequency | Typical Payouts | Player Appeal |
|---|---|---|---|
| Low Variance | High | Small, frequent wins | Casual play, beginner-friendly |
| High Variance | Low | Larger, less frequent jackpots | Thrill-seekers, high-risk players |

Technical Innovations Enhancing Player Trust
The industry increasingly embraces blockchain and open-source algorithms to foster transparency. For example, games like the Plinko Dice slot often incorporate cryptographic verification, which allows players to independently verify the fairness of each spin. This approach shifts some of the trust from the operator to the technology itself, a move that resonates strongly with conscientious players and regulatory bodies alike.
